The Animal Welfare Committee of the IVSA is essentially working on improving animals’ rights and their freedoms through raising awareness and conducting projects all around the world, all of which will be for better animal welfare standards.

As a first step into achieving the goals that we have for the committee, setting up the team members is a primary move before starting to work on projects.

During the past month of September we set up a structure for the committee and decided which positions we would like to have for the most efficient results. Afterwards, we had the application period running for IVSA students to take place in the committee. At the end of this stage, it has been a great success for us to have an amazing and diverse team ready and motivated for all the work coming up.

Altogether, we have managed to recruit three project managers, two educational officers, a liaison officer, an internal PR, and a local officer Coordinator for the Animal Welfare Committee.

The upcoming projects in this current stage of our work will be concentrated specifically on the creation of the animal welfare website as our priority during the next couple of months. During this time, we will be running other projects to raise awareness about animal welfare for veterinary students and people. Beginning next week, we are starting up a new idea - publishing Animal Welfare “Did You Know?” facts from all over around the world on our Facebook page.

On the other hand, our coordinator for the local officers of the Animal Welfare Committee will be inviting and motivating multiple Member Organisations from the IVSA family to contribute and have an officer within their chapter to help spread the importance of animal welfare in their faculty. This will be done through the creation of a project that will involve all IVSA chapters during the next stage of our committee work.

Our committee is also currently contributing to the Working Group on Policy Statements and Position Papers in regards to animal welfare issues within IVSA official views.
